Performing pooja in Gokarna is an essential aspect of Hindu rituals, and it is believed to help in seeking blessings, showing gratitude, and connecting with the divine.
Gokarna is a small town in the south-west state of Karnataka in India. It is a significant pilgrimage center for Hindus and is home to many ancient temples, including the famous Mahabaleshwar Temple in Gokarna. The town is also known for its beautiful beaches, natural beauty, and serene atmosphere. The town attracts many devotees who come to seek blessings from Lord Shiva and perform pooja, a Hindu ritual that is an essential part of the Hindu tradition. The Mahabaleshwar Temple:
The Mahabaleshwar Temple is dedicated to Lord Shiva, and it is one of the oldest temples in Gokarna. The temple is built in the Dravidian style of architecture, and it is a beautiful example of ancient Indian architecture. The temple is famous for its Atmalinga, which is believed to be a manifestation of Lord Shiva. The Atmalinga is a sacred stone that is worshipped by devotees who come to seek the blessings of Lord Shiva. The temple is also home to many other deities, and pooja is performed daily in the temple.
Pooja in the Mahabaleshwar Temple:
Pooja is an essential part of the daily routine in the Mahabaleshwar Temple. The pooja is performed by the priests, and it is a way to offer prayers and offerings to the deities. The pooja involves the chanting of mantras, offering of flowers and other items to the deities, and the lighting of lamps. The priests also offer food to the deities, and the prasad is distributed among the devotees. The pooja is a way to seek the blessings of the deities and to show our gratitude and devotion.
Other Temples in Gokarna:
Apart from the Mahabaleshwar Temple, Gokarna is home to many other ancient temples, including the Maha Ganapati Temple, the Tamra Gowri Temple, and the Bhadrakali Temple. Pooja is performed daily in these temples, and devotees come to seek the blessings of the deities. Each temple has its own unique rituals and procedures for pooja, and it is a way to connect with the divine.
